Mosher v. Mosher

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York, Second Department
Mar 22, 1943
266 App. Div. 686 (N.Y. App. Div. 1943)

Opinion

March 22, 1943.


Appeal by defendant husband, in an action in which plaintiff wife obtained a judgment of separation, from an order (a) granting plaintiff's motion for a modification of the judgment by increasing the alimony from fifteen dollars to twenty-five dollars a week and allowing a counsel fee of fifty dollars, and (b) denying defendant's motion to confirm the report of an official referee. Order affirmed, with ten dollars costs and disbursements. No opinion. Carswell, Johnston, Adel, Taylor and Lewis, JJ., concur.
